Overview

Bingbing Ni is affiliated with Shanghai Jiao Tong University in China. Their research primarily focuses on computer science, with a significant number of publications concentrated in the subfields of computer vision and pattern recognition, artificial intelligence, computational mechanics, computer graphics and computer-aided design, and radiology, nuclear medicine, and imaging.

The scientist's research topics include 3D shape modeling and analysis, human pose and action recognition, advanced vision and imaging, generative adversarial networks and image synthesis, computer graphics and visualization techniques, domain adaptation and few-shot learning, as well as multimodal machine learning applications.

Frequent co-authors collaborating with Bingbing Ni include Jiancheng Yang, Wenjun Zhang, Xuanhong Chen, Donglai Wei, and Hanspeter Pfister.

Key publication venues for this scientist cover multiple reputable platforms and conferences, such as arXiv (Cornell University), Zenodo (CERN European Organization for Nuclear Research), Proceedings of the AAAI Conference on Artificial Intelligence, IEEE Transactions on Pattern Analysis and Machine Intelligence, and the 2021 IEEE/CVF International Conference on Computer Vision (ICCV).
